FAQs

Hotels with self-service laundry facilities in Tacna typically offer washers and dryers that guests can access at their convenience. These amenities are usually located in common areas, such as near the gym or pool. Additionally, these hotels might provide laundry detergents for purchase, folding tables, and cleaning supplies to facilitate the laundry process.


In a hotel setting, self-service laundry typically involves guests using provided machines to wash and dry their clothing. Guests simply load their laundry into the machines, add detergent, and choose the appropriate cycle settings. Once the wash is complete, they can transfer their clothes to the dryers. Many hotels operate on a pay-per-use model, where guests might need to purchase tokens or pay via a kiosk.


While many hotels with self-service laundry facilities strive to make these amenities available around the clock, access may vary. Some hotels may restrict laundry room hours for maintenance or security reasons. It’s advisable to check with the hotel directly regarding the operating hours to ensure you have access when needed.


When planning to use self-service laundry facilities in hotels, it’s beneficial to pack a small kit that includes laundry detergent, fabric softener, and dryer sheets if you prefer using them. Additionally, having a foldable laundry bag or mesh bags for delicates can be helpful. It's also wise to carry a few extra hangers for air drying clothes if needed.


While using self-service laundry facilities in hotels, the risk of losing clothing typically depends on the individual’s attentiveness. To minimize this risk, guests should always keep an eye on their laundry and promptly retrieve it once the cycle is complete. Additionally, labeling your clothing can be a prudent step in case items are accidentally mixed with others.
